Reviews (490)

Overall rating
4.6
Counts per rating level
  • 87% of ratings are 5 stars
  • 5% of ratings are 4 stars
  • 2% of ratings are 3 stars
  • 0% of ratings are 2 stars
  • 6% of ratings are 1 stars
All reviews
June 23, 2017

Thanks for the great service and customer support from the SEO Manager team. Installed without any issues and it helps us resolve daily SEO issues that saves us a ton of time. I recommend all businesses to give this a shot.

Klatch Coffee Roasting
United States
18 days using the app